Title: Configure Delayed Redelivery

Describe the issue:
Last paragraph says: "Address wildcards can be used on the <address-setting-match> element to configure the redelivery delay for addresses which match the wildcard."

However there is no element <address-setting-match>.


Suggestions for improvement:

The text should say something like "Address wildcards can be used on match attribute of <address-setting> element to configure..."
